In the mid-Nineteenth century, handsome Thomas Cartwright is the envy of his peers. He has overcome adversity; the loss of both parents in a boating accident on the River Humber while he was only four. Yet now, in adulthood, he is a partner in a thriving shipyard. And he has the love of two strikingly beautiful women. Maria, dark and sensuous, is rescued by Thomas from a house of ill-repute. Kate Earnshaw, as fair as Maria is dark, is the daughter of the richest man in Kingston-upon-Hull. Yet Thomas's life becomes a tangled web of violence, deceit and treachery, and The Harbinger Of Doom still has appalling cards to play...
